Since this month's theme is Home Entertainment, I thought you might be interested in iVillage's list of items that are essential to throwing a good home-based party. I've excerpted part of the list below, and while I don't agree that disposable hand towels are a party essential (setting out several hand towels next to the sink is a more economical and environmental option), most of these tips are definite party musts. Since I have a party coming up this weekend — a traditional German Christmas party called a Feuerzangenbowle that my fiancé throws every year — I know that I'm going to take iVillage's advice and stock up on many of these supplies.

- Invitations. Set the tone for your holiday gathering with an invitation that reflects your party style — casual or formal, trendy or traditional.
- Fresh flowers. Flowers are a lovely and welcoming addition to a table or a guest bedroom. Buy a bunch and use them for decoration.
- Party favors. Send guests home with a small favor to help them remember your gathering. Candles, photographs, and cookies are fun and festive options.
- Centerpiece. Assemble a holiday-themed centerpiece. For Christmas, find pine garlands, holly, mistletoe, and pine cones. For Hanukkah, purchase dreidels and chocolate gelt.
- Firewood. A roaring fire will make your guests feel cozy and warm on a cold night. An even better option is using a Duraflame log. If you don't have a fireplace, and add a soft glow with candles.
- Wreaths. Create an inviting entrance to your home with a seasonal wreath. Eucalyptus or pine will evoke the spirit of the holidays.
- Soap. Fancy soaps, whether molded or French milled, will make your guests feel pampered.
